服务器虚拟化解决方案设计,深度解析,基于服务器虚拟化技术的创新解决方案与应用实践
- 综合资讯
- 2024-12-22 01:49:51
- 2

摘要:本文深入探讨服务器虚拟化解决方案的设计与实施,从技术原理出发,详述创新解决方案及其在实践中的应用,旨在为读者提供全面的服务器虚拟化技术理解与应用指导。...
摘要:本文深入探讨服务器虚拟化解决方案的设计与实施,从技术原理出发,详述创新解决方案及其在实践中的应用,旨在为读者提供全面的服务器虚拟化技术理解与应用指导。
随着信息技术的飞速发展,企业对计算资源的需求日益增长,传统的物理服务器在资源利用率、扩展性、管理成本等方面存在诸多不足,服务器虚拟化技术应运而生,通过将物理服务器虚拟化为多个虚拟机,实现资源的灵活分配和高效利用,本文将深入探讨服务器虚拟化解决方案的设计与实施,并分析其在实际应用中的优势。
服务器虚拟化技术概述
1、服务器虚拟化定义
服务器虚拟化是指将一台物理服务器分割成多个虚拟机,每个虚拟机拥有独立的操作系统和资源,实现物理资源与虚拟资源的分离,虚拟化技术包括硬件虚拟化、操作系统虚拟化和应用虚拟化等层次。
2、服务器虚拟化技术优势
(1)提高资源利用率:虚拟化技术可以将物理服务器资源进行整合,提高资源利用率,降低能耗。
(2)简化运维管理:虚拟化技术可以实现自动化部署、备份、恢复等操作,降低运维成本。
(3)提高系统可靠性:虚拟化技术可以将业务部署在多个虚拟机上,实现负载均衡,提高系统可靠性。
(4)增强灵活性:虚拟化技术可以实现快速部署、扩展和迁移,满足企业业务发展的需求。
服务器虚拟化解决方案设计
1、虚拟化平台选择
根据企业需求,选择合适的虚拟化平台,目前主流的虚拟化平台有VMware、Microsoft Hyper-V、Citrix XenServer等,以下是几种虚拟化平台的优缺点:
(1)VMware:功能强大,兼容性好,但成本较高。
(2)Microsoft Hyper-V:与Windows操作系统集成,成本低,但功能相对较弱。
(3)Citrix XenServer:开源免费,性能优越,但市场占有率较低。
2、虚拟化架构设计
根据企业规模和业务需求,设计合理的虚拟化架构,以下为常见的虚拟化架构:
(1)单节点虚拟化:适用于小型企业,资源需求不高。
(2)集群虚拟化:适用于大型企业,实现负载均衡、故障转移等功能。
(3)分布式虚拟化:适用于跨地域、跨数据中心的虚拟化部署。
3、虚拟化资源规划
(1)CPU资源:根据虚拟机数量和性能需求,合理分配CPU资源。
(2)内存资源:根据虚拟机数量和操作系统类型,合理分配内存资源。
(3)存储资源:根据业务需求,选择合适的存储方案,如本地存储、网络存储等。
(4)网络资源:根据业务需求,规划虚拟化网络,实现负载均衡、安全隔离等功能。
服务器虚拟化解决方案实施
1、环境准备
(1)硬件设备:确保物理服务器满足虚拟化平台的要求。
(2)操作系统:安装虚拟化平台所需的操作系统。
(3)网络设备:配置虚拟化网络,确保虚拟机之间的通信。
2、虚拟化平台部署
(1)安装虚拟化平台:按照官方文档进行安装。
(2)配置虚拟化平台:设置虚拟化平台的各项参数,如CPU、内存、存储等。
(3)创建虚拟机:根据业务需求,创建所需的虚拟机。
3、虚拟机部署
(1)安装操作系统:在虚拟机上安装所需的操作系统。
(2)配置应用程序:在虚拟机上安装和配置应用程序。
(3)数据迁移:将物理服务器上的数据迁移到虚拟机。
4、虚拟化运维管理
(1)监控:实时监控虚拟化平台和虚拟机的运行状态。
(2)备份与恢复:定期备份虚拟机,确保数据安全。
(3)性能优化:根据业务需求,对虚拟化平台和虚拟机进行性能优化。
服务器虚拟化解决方案应用实践
1、案例一:某企业采用VMware虚拟化平台,将原有物理服务器虚拟化为20个虚拟机,实现了资源的高效利用和运维成本的降低。
2、案例二:某银行采用Citrix XenServer虚拟化平台,将业务系统部署在多个虚拟机上,实现了负载均衡和故障转移,提高了系统可靠性。
3、案例三:某互联网公司采用分布式虚拟化技术,将业务系统部署在多个数据中心,实现了跨地域的负载均衡和故障转移,提高了业务连续性。
服务器虚拟化技术为企业提供了高效、灵活、可靠的计算资源,本文深入探讨了服务器虚拟化解决方案的设计与实施,并分析了其在实际应用中的优势,通过合理的设计和实施,企业可以实现资源的高效利用、运维成本的降低和业务连续性的提高,随着虚拟化技术的不断发展,服务器虚拟化解决方案将在未来发挥更加重要的作用。
本文链接:https://zhitaoyun.cn/1712663.html
发表评论